Fall Festival a Success

On Saturday, November 7th, the Jackson Area Chamber of Commerce hosted its 27th Annual Fall Festival. Our goal for this year’s event was to increase attendance and to make it our biggest and best Fall Festival ever!

This year’s event attracted thousands of spectators to the Jackson area who in turn brought added revenue to our city. Downtown Jackson was filled with live entertainment, over sixty Market in the Street vendors, over twenty food vendors, the Third Annual Clarke-Mobile Gas Chili Cook-Off, over 100 participants in the Bob Smith Memorial Antique Auto Show, over ten Motorcycle Show enthusiasts, several lumberjack competitors and well over 500 children showed for the Kid’s Games.
